What they do

A Human Resources Specialist works for a human resources department to implement the provisions of a labor contract, including employee wages and benefits and other practices that are collectively bargained; may also handle an internal grievance process established under a labor contract.

Job Description

We are seeking an experienced Recruiting Specialist with hands-on NEOGOV experience to support recruitment and staffing efforts for a public-facing organization in North Miami, Florida. This is a long-term contract opportunity supporting the full recruitment process across a variety of administrative, professional, technical, and community-focused positions.

Candidates must have previous experience working with NEOGOV to be considered for this opportunity.ResponsibilitiesManage full-cycle recruiting activities, from posting open positions through candidate selection and onboarding coordinationCreate and manage job postings within NEOGOVReview applications and resumes to identify qualified candidatesConduct candidate screenings and coordinate interviews with hiring managersMaintain candidate records, recruitment documentation, and status updates within NEOGOVSource candidates through job boards, community outreach, career events, professional networks, and other recruiting channelsBuild and maintain candidate pipelines for current and future hiring needsCommunicate with applicants throughout the recruitment and selection processCoordinate interview schedules, candidate follow-ups, and pre-employment requirementsPartner with hiring managers and internal teams to understand staffing needs and candidate requirementsSupport recruitment practices consistent with applicable public-sector hiring procedures and organizational policiesAssist with outreach efforts designed to attract a broad and qualified applicant pool
